New Start!
February 1st will be a new beginning in frugality for me. Over the past 4-6 months, I have slowly drifted away from my frugal self...Not in the spending department. I've maintained my bargain and cut to the bone spending. What I haven't kept up with are all the little daily things that keep my utilities in line.
I did really well last water cycle...but this one...We don't wanna talk about.
As for shutting off lights, apliances, etc....uuuum....who me?
So, I am going to sit down with my sorely neglected frugal notebook and make a list of my savings routines. I will follow them resolutely beginning Feb. 1st and come March I will reap the rewards once more!
